Genesys:An integrated simulation and synthesis design tool for RF/microwave circuit board and subsystem designers
Genesys is endorsed by an installed base of over 5,000 satisfied RF and microwave designers worldwide, many of whom have been loyal repeat customers over the past 30 years. Gen esys in corporates breakthrough nonlinear X-parameter simulation and is backed by Keysight's extensive industry-wide expertise in RF/ microwave design, instrumentation and support. As a proven safe investment, Genesys literally pays for itself through cost savings within its first year of deployment as a design productivity tool. As your requirements expand to include enterprise level design of RF/high speed boards, MMICs or multi-technology RF system-in-package (SIP) modules, Keysight Tech no Logies, inc. protects your Genesys investment by providing full trade-up cred't towards the even more capable Advanced Design System (ADS).
